What Are Carbohydrates?
Carbohydrates are one of the three classic macronutrients, sitting alongside proteins and fats on every nutrition label. In plain terms, they’re chains of sugar molecules—think of glucose, fructose, and lactose—as well as the fiber that ties them together. You’ll find them in everything from a crunchy apple to a hearty bowl of oatmeal, and even in the starchy backbone of pasta or rice.
Simple vs. Complex
Simple carbs are the quick‑acting sugars that spike blood glucose fast. Fruit sugars, table sugar, and milk sugar fall into this camp. Complex carbs, on the other hand, are longer chains that take longer to break down. Whole grains, legumes, and starchy vegetables are the slow‑burn fuel that keeps energy steady Still holds up..
The Role of Fiber
Fiber isn’t digested for energy, but it’s still a carbohydrate. It passes through the digestive tract largely intact, helping regulate bowel movements and feeding the gut microbiome. Think of it as the “clean‑up crew” of the carb world.

How Carbohydrates Work in the Body
1. Primary Energy Source
The brain runs almost exclusively on glucose, especially when you’re solving problems or staying focused. Muscles also prefer carbs for high‑intensity activity because they can be broken down quickly and produce ATP—the cell’s energy currency—more efficiently than fats.
2. Storage as Glycogen
Excess glucose gets tucked away in the liver and muscles as glycogen. Think of it as a personal fuel tank you can dip into later, like a reserve tank for a road trip. When you’re fasting or exercising, glycogen is released back into the bloodstream to keep energy levels up.
3. Structural Role in Cells
Some carbohydrates become part of the cell’s architecture. Cellulose, for instance, gives plants their rigid cell walls, while chitin forms the exoskeletons of insects and crustaceans. In humans, glycosylation—the attachment of sugar molecules to proteins—helps proteins fold correctly and signals where they should go in the body.
4. Building Blocks for Other Molecules
Carbohydrate derivatives serve as precursors for nucleotides (the building blocks of DNA and RNA) and certain amino acids. In short, they’re the scaffolding that helps your cells construct genetic material and protein chains.
5. Influence on Blood Sugar and Insulin
When carbs hit the bloodstream, they raise blood glucose. The pancreas releases insulin to shuttle that glucose into cells for energy or storage. This dance between glucose and insulin is central to metabolism, weight management, and even mood regulation But it adds up..
Common Misconceptions About Carb Functions
Most people think carbs are just “energy” and nothing else. That oversimplification leads to two big mistakes:
- Assuming all carbs are the same. Fiber, starches, and sugars behave differently in the body. Fiber doesn’t raise blood sugar, while simple sugars do.
- Believing carbs are “bad” for weight loss. In reality, the right kind of carbs fuels performance and helps preserve muscle mass while you shed fat.
Another frequent myth is that carbs can build muscle directly. While they provide the energy needed for protein synthesis, the actual muscle tissue comes from amino acids, not glucose Small thing, real impact..

Understanding Carb Quality: Beyond the Basics
The glycemic index (GI) offers another lens for evaluating carb quality. Low-GI foods like legumes and steel-cut oats release glucose gradually, supporting sustained energy and better insulin sensitivity. High-GI foods cause rapid spikes followed by crashes, often leading to increased hunger and fat storage And it works..
That said, GI alone doesn't tell the full story. Worth adding: a food's glycemic load (GL) accounts for both the type and amount of carbohydrate, providing a more practical measure for portion planning. Watermelon, for instance, has a high GI but low GL due to its minimal carb content per serving.

The Fiber Factor
Soluble fiber forms a gel-like substance in the digestive tract, slowing digestion and helping regulate blood sugar levels. And it also binds to cholesterol, aiding cardiovascular health. Insoluble fiber adds bulk to stool and promotes regular bowel movements, supporting overall digestive wellness.
Most adults consume only 10-15 grams of daily fiber, well below the recommended 25-35 grams. Increasing fiber intake gradually allows gut bacteria to adapt, minimizing uncomfortable bloating while maximizing benefits Easy to understand, harder to ignore..

Cooking Methods Matter
Steaming, roasting, and boiling preserve more nutrients than frying. Cooling cooked potatoes or rice actually increases resistant starch content, creating prebiotic benefits for gut health.
